Peptide-Lipid Huge Toroidal Pore, a New Antimicrobial Mechanism Mediated by a Lactococcal Bacteriocin, Lacticin Q

Lacticin Q is a pore-forming bacteriocin produced by Lactococcus lactis QU 5, and its antimicrobial activity is in the nanomolar range.
